October 14, 2021 (Vancouver, BC) – Nanaimo’s Foley Dog Treat Company has partnered with the BC Hospitality Foundation (BCHF) and BC SPCA with the launch of their new baked dog treats: Wander Dog “Treats for traveling pups”. Foley Dog Treat Company will donate $0.50 from each bag sold to both BCHF & BC SPCA. The charity hopes that local hotels and tourist attractions that welcome dogs and their guardians will support the initiative by purchasing treats to give to their canine “clientele.”
Foley Dog Treat Company Owner/Operator, Daniel Stiefvater, has worked his entire career in the hospitality and wine industry. With many of his previous colleagues being recipients of BCHF support and scholarships, he wanted to continue to support the great work that BCHF does. He says, “this is a perfect crossover project from my previous hospitality life to what I’m doing today in the pet industry. With nearly 50% of Canadian households having at least one four-legged-family-member, it’s increasingly important for hotel and hospitality operators to welcome pets, and these treats are an excellent amenity. And in turn, they will support two great charities”.

Wander Dog “Treats for traveling pups” are made from wild Pacific salmon and Saskatoon berries. Packaged in 170g recyclable bags, produced in Vancouver, they feature an abstract painting created by Rogan the dog. Yes, a dog painted the package!
Rogan, a miniature Australian shepherd from Medicine Hat, Alta., started painting in 2020. His owner, Megan Bolen, says it was supposed to be something fun to do together. To date, Rogan has painted over 200 paintings and has raised over $5,000 for local rescues. His work appeared in an art exhibit in Hong Kong earlier this year resulting in one of his biggest accomplishments thus far.

The BCHF thanks the Foley Dog Treat Company for its generosity! Funds raised by the initiative will support hospitality industry workers facing financial crisis due to a serious health condition experienced by themselves or a family member. The registered charity also administers a scholarship program that fosters the development of the next generation of hospitality industry workers and leaders.
